: except dont buy a stand alone -r format panasonic especially It's interesting that there are such vastly differing experiences. Probably having more to do with the media than the player. I've got a +R unit gathering dust because I can only play back discs on itself. Other stock DVD players, computers, and duplication towers won't recognize the discs! Interesting, ain't it? In addition, none of the DVD+R discs that have been brought to me for duplication have been readable in either the stock DVD players, computer drives, or duplication towers. I will say that while the discs burned on the Panasonic are easily read in both computers and duplicators, the COPIES of those discs play back better in regular DVD players. That may be what yayaya-beaver is referring to. It's really not a problem for me, because I always keep the original master in the studio for future duplications anyway, and only ever give clients the copies.
